Mount Burrell is a town and a mountain in the Nightcap Range in the Tweed Shire in the Northern Rivers region of New South Wales, Australia.

The peak of Mount Burrell has an elevation of 933 metres (3,061 ft) above sea level, approximately 8 kilometres (5.0 mi) north of Nimbin.
